What is an equation of the line that passes through the point (-5, -3) and is
parallel to the line 3x + 5y = 15?

Answer:

  3x +5y = -30

Step-by-step explanation:

The parallel line can have the same x- and y-coefficients. You can find the value of the new constant by using the given point for x and y:

  3x +5y = 3(-5) +5(-3) = -30

  3x +5y = -30
